Hi, We are listed in a well in columbiana and the way I found out was a water testing notice that had a well name listed. We are leased through Chesapeake and my lease calls for this test so you have to read your lease. This well is still not on the odnr site and the number I called for the oil company said it a proposed well, but i found the spot due to a zillion stakes in a field. You can also get a water notice if you are within so many feet of the unit but not in it.
